二、What are some methods to enhance the comfort level of operating an aluminum ingot chip cutting machine


Working with an aluminum ingot chip cutting machine doesn't have to be a comfortless chore, and there are several methods you can employ to ensure that operating this heavy machinery isn't a drag on your body and min One significant way to up the comfort level is by customizing the machine's control Adjustable levers, buttons, and touchscreens positioned within easy reach can make all the difference, reducing the need for awkward stretching or bending that can lead to muscle strai Consider upgrading the seating as well; ergonomic chairs with proper lumbar support and adjustable heights can keep your posture in check and stave off back pai Machines can be noisy beasts, so investing in sound dampening materials around the workspace can also help lower the decibel levels, protecting your hearing and reducing the relentless assault of noise on your sense Proper lighting is a game changer; bright, well-placed lights can alleviate eye strain and help you stay focused without squinting or bending too close to your wor Keep tools and materials within arm's reach by organizing your workspace efficiently; disorder can not only lead to discomfort but also increases the risk of accident Regular maintenance of the machine itself can prevent unexpected jerks and starts that can jostle the operator, ensuring the cutting action is always smooth and predictabl Don't overlook the power of regular breaks as well; stepping away from the machine allows your body to reset and can reduce the build-up of fatigu Consider integrating technology that monitors and reports on usage patterns, so adjustments can be made proactively to the way you interact with the machin Personal protective equipment should not be just safety-oriented but also comfortable; gloves should provide both grip and softness, safety glasses should not pinch, and ear protection should fit well without causing headache Lastly, the work environment plays a crucial role, so ensure there is ample ventilation to keep fresh air circulating and maintain a comfortable temperature as extreme heat or cold can greatly affect comfort level By addressing these aspects, the operability of an aluminum ingot chip cutting machine can be made far more comfortable, which not only promotes a more pleasant work experience but also contributes to better efficiency and productivit Remember, your welfare is paramount, so taking the time to implement these comfort-enhancing methods is a worthwhile investment in both your health and the quality of your wor

四、What to do if aluminum chips from machining a car part do not break off continuously


Machining car parts can get a tad frustrating, especially when those pesky aluminum chips just won't break off the way they're supposed to, huh? You're shaping and shaving metal, expecting neat little curls of aluminum to fall away, but instead, you're left with a clingy mes Let's talk about how you can smooth out this process without losing your coo See, aluminum is soft and has a knack for gumming up your tools, leading to those annoying continuous chip Make sure your cutting tools are sharp; dull tools are offenders for chip trouble Also, check your feed rate and the depth of the cut; they play a massive role in chip managemen Too slow or too shallow, and you're inviting troubl Lubrication is another hero in this tal A proper cutting fluid reduces friction and cools down the cutting area, encouraging those chips to take a break and fall away easie Then there's the tool path – consider optimizing the movement of your tool to manage the direction and formation of chip You could also play around with different cutting tool materials and geometries; there's a whole world of options designed for chip breakag Let's not forget about chip breakers – these clever little features on cutting tools force the chips to break at certain length Think about using a high-pressure coolant system as well; it blasts chips away from your workpiece like nobody's busines But sometimes, you may need to stop and clear the chips manually, annoying, but it's better than damaging your part or too Jammed chips can cause all sorts of trouble like tool breakage, surface finish issues, or wors Keep an eye on how your machine sounds and feels; often, it'll protest with weird noises or vibrations if things aren't chipping away as they shoul Routine maintenance on your machines ensures everything is running smoothly and reduces chip issue Remember, aluminum chips that don't break off continuously are indeed a thorn in the side of a smooth machining proces Figuring out the right combination of tooling, technique, and tweaks can assure that next time you're in for a far less clingy experience, and those chips will know exactly where they're supposed to go – anywhere but here!
